Box 1969 <br />Bayfield, CO 81122 <br />Re: Water Supply for the Simmons Gravel Facility <br />Dear Peter: <br />The proposed site for the Simmons Gravel Facility is located in Section 31, Township 36 N. <br />Range 13 West of the N.M.P.M. west of Mancos, CO. It is Wright Water Engineers, Inc's <br />(WWE's) understanding that the gravel facility will be a dry mining facility with water needs for <br />periodic material washing only. The amount of material washed is an estimated 120,000 tons <br />over 3 months or 40,000 tons per month. WWE understands that the washing facility is a <br />mobile facility and will be brought on the site intermittently to wash material. To provide the <br />water for gravel washing and settling, two ponds with a combined surface area of 0.22 acres is <br />anticipated. <br />Water Depletions <br />Water depletions for the gravel operation will be from pond evaporation and material washing. <br />Each component of water depletion is described more full below. <br />Evaporation <br />The calculated net evaporation rate for Mancos is 2.78 acre-feet per acre per year (AF/yr). <br />Based on a combined surface area of 0.22 AF, the calculated maximum annual depletion for <br />evaporation is 0.61 AF/yr (see Table 1). <br />Material Washing <br />Estimations of water depletions from the aggregate and sand washing are based on General <br />Guidelines for Substitute Water Supply Plans for Sand and Gravel Pits Submitted to the State <br />Engineer Pursuant to SB 89-120 and SB 93-260 (General Guidelines).
